This subcontract for Geotechnical Engineering Services supports U.S. Department of State projects at the U.S. Embassy in Bogota. The selected provider will perform geotechnical investigations, including soil boring and laboratory testing, to collect data and analyze soil properties. These activities are essential to validate seismic compliance and determine the load-bearing capacity of the site, culminating in the delivery of a comprehensive geotechnical report and data set. The contract requires the services of a Licensed Professional Engineer authorized to practice in Colombia. Interested parties must respond by September 14, 2026, for this opportunity categorized under NAICS code 541330. All performance activities will take place in Bogota, Colombia.
